Society’s growing demand for energy and minerals(矿石) has motivated engineering industries to maximize the productivity of these resources and investigate the exploitation of new resources in increasingly challenging environments. Reservoir stimulations in, for example, tight-gas shales and engineered geothermal systems have ,e normal practice in the exploitation and development of these energy resources. The technologies use hydraulic fracturing to engineer the reservoir rock properties by inducing new fractures and enhancing the existing work for permeability.

The aim of a hydraulic treatment is thus the creation of pathways between different volumes within the reservoir or to enhance the conductivity of pre-existing joints.
